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
338 933 381
8374780968 09330751079 5424569
8374780968 09330751079 5424569
6422753 9729 23613554
All about undefined
Interested in learning more?
8374780968 09330751079 5424569
6422753 9729 23613554
See more
895234 0839042 161226
79 03562746 32 1156974
See more
54264 51692049
6144 07 6370266241 108
See more